Subject: [Intel-gfx] [PATCH 5/8] drm/i915/perf: Ensure observation logic is not clock gated

A clock gating switch can control if the performance monitoring and
observation logic is enaled or not. Ensure that we enable the clocks.

v2: Separate code from other patches (Lionel)
v3: Reset PMON enable when disabling perf to save power (Lionel)
v4: Use intel_uncore_rmw and REG_BIT (Chris)

diff --git a/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/i915_perf.c b/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/i915_perf.c
index 2f01b8c0284c..3ded6e7d8526 100644
--- a/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/i915_perf.c
+++ b/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/i915_perf.c
@@ -2553,6 +2553,12 @@ gen12_enable_metric_set(struct i915_perf_stream *stream,
 			    (period_exponent << GEN12_OAG_OAGLBCTXCTRL_TIMER_PERIOD_SHIFT))
 			    : 0);
 
+	/*
+	 * Initialize Super Queue Internal Cnt Register
+	 * Set PMON Enable in order to collect valid metrics.
+	 */
+	intel_uncore_rmw(uncore, GEN12_SQCNT1, 0, GEN12_SQCNT1_PMON_ENABLE);
+
 	/*
 	 * Update all contexts prior writing the mux configurations as we need
 	 * to make sure all slices/subslices are ON before writing to NOA
@@ -2612,6 +2618,9 @@ static void gen12_disable_metric_set(struct i915_perf_stream *stream)
 
 	/* Make sure we disable noa to save power. */
 	intel_uncore_rmw(uncore, RPM_CONFIG1, GEN10_GT_NOA_ENABLE, 0);
+
+	/* Reset PMON Enable to save power. */
+	intel_uncore_rmw(uncore, GEN12_SQCNT1, GEN12_SQCNT1_PMON_ENABLE, 0);
 }
 
 static void gen7_oa_enable(struct i915_perf_stream *stream)
diff --git a/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/i915_reg.h b/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/i915_reg.h
index 40943dd5e0db..77ece19bda7e 100644
--- a/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/i915_reg.h
+++ b/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/i915_reg.h
@@ -718,6 +718,8 @@ static inline bool i915_mmio_reg_valid(i915_reg_t reg)
 #define OABUFFER_SIZE_16M   (7 << 3)
 
 #define GEN12_OA_TLB_INV_CR _MMIO(0xceec)
+#define GEN12_SQCNT1 _MMIO(0x8718)
+#define  GEN12_SQCNT1_PMON_ENABLE REG_BIT(30)
 
 /* Gen12 OAR unit */
 #define GEN12_OAR_OACONTROL _MMIO(0x2960)
